The average bus between Newton Center and South Station takes 48 min and the fastest bus takes 34 min. The bus service runs several times per day from Newton Center to South Station.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Buses run every 2 hours between Newton Center and South Station. The earliest departure is at 6:44 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Newton Center is at 6:18 PM which arrives into South Station at 7:10 PM. All services require a transfer at Galen St @ Water St and take an average of 48 min.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ct bus from Newton Center to South Station. However, there are services departing from Newton Center station and arriving at South Station station via Galen St @ Water St.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 48 min.
Newton Center to South Station bus services, operated by MBTA, depart from Centre St @ Langley Rd station.
Newton Center to South Station bus services, operated by MBTA, arrive at Lincoln St @ Essex St station.
The distance between Newton Center and South Station is 11.7 km. The road distance is 18 km.
You can take a bus from Centre St @ Langley Rd to South Station via Galen St @ Water St, Technology Way @ Watertown Yard, and Lincoln St @ Essex St in around 1h 4m.
